Patagonia

Timesaving measures are in effect so we're going the picture-worth-a-thousand-words route. In summary: Patagonia is breathtakingly beautiful and terrifically windy. I spent a week backpacking the "W" trail in Parque Nacional Torres del Paine with two friends, we met up with Molly and Elise almost by accident on our second day and spent the rest of the time with them. We also met nearly the entire population of Germany on the trail, as well as probably half of Israel. Lots of laughter, lots of hiking, a little bit of snow, a little bit of rain, a little bit of sun.
